Two-vehicle crash with trapped person at Ingleside Ave, Catonsville MD


A two-vehicle crash occurred at Baltimore National Pike and Ingleside Avenue involving a gray Nissan Altima and a white Honda sedan. One person was partially trapped, unable to open the door, and had neck and head pain. Another person suffered a broken hip injury, and a female had pain. All were conscious and breathing. Police were on the scene.
